Key Financial Performance

Total Revenue (Q3 2025) $71.6 million, representing a 45% increase over the same period in 2024 and a 12% sequential increase from the second quarter of this year. The increase was driven by strong demand across key products like VEVYE and IHEEZO.

Total Revenue (First 9 months of 2025) $183.2 million, showing strong year-to-date growth. The growth is attributed to disciplined execution and rising demand for key products.

Adjusted EBITDA (Q3 2025) $22.7 million. This reflects the company's ability to translate revenue growth into earnings, showcasing operating leverage.

GAAP-based Net Income (Q3 2025) $1 million. This indicates profitability while maintaining stable operating expenses.

VEVYE Revenue (Q3 2025) $22.6 million, a 22% increase from the second quarter of 2025. The growth was driven by increased unit volumes and strong demand.

IHEEZO Revenue (Q3 2025) $21.9 million, a 20% increase from the second quarter of 2025. Despite a seasonal slowdown in July and August, demand rebounded sharply in September.

TRIESENCE and Specialty Portfolio Revenue (Q3 2025) $6.9 million, a 33% sequential increase. Growth was driven by new leadership, a dedicated sales force, and the launch of the Harrow Access for All program.

ImprimisRx Revenue (Q3 2025) $20.1 million. The revenue remained stable, but a potential dispute with the California Board of Pharmacy and an inventory shortage in October may impact future performance.

Operating Highlights

VEVYE: Delivered 22% quarter-over-quarter revenue growth. Signed agreements with leading national payers for preferred product status starting January 2026, improving coverage and access.

IHEEZO: Achieved 20% quarter-over-quarter revenue growth despite seasonal slowdown. Positioned for a strong finish to 2025.

TRIESENCE: Underperformed earlier but gaining traction in retina and launched into ocular inflammation market in October 2025, showing positive early feedback.

MELT-300: Acquisition of Melt Pharmaceuticals and its non-opioid procedural sedation candidate MELT-300 is underway.

Dry Eye Market: VEVYE captured 10.5% of the total dry eye market, doubling its market share in two quarters. Positioned to become the leading cyclosporine therapy in the U.S.

Ocular Inflammation Market: TRIESENCE launched into this market, the largest opportunity for the product to date.

Revenue Growth: Achieved 45% year-over-year revenue growth in Q3 2025, with total revenue of $71.6 million. Updated full-year revenue outlook to $270-$280 million.

Commercial Infrastructure: Built a scalable infrastructure to support multiple product launches and expansion without heavy additional investment.

Product Launches: Preparing for 4 product launches over the next 3 years, including BYOOVIZ, OPUVIZ, BYQLOVI, and MELT-300.

Access for All Program: Expanded this program across the entire ophthalmic portfolio to improve affordability and patient access.

Risk or Challenges

Regulatory Hurdles: The company is engaged in a dispute with the California Board of Pharmacy regarding the renewal of its ImprimisRx license, which is set to expire on December 1, 2025. Failure to resolve this issue could impact operations in California.

Product Performance Variability: While VEVYE and IHEEZO are performing strongly, TRIESENCE and the broader specialty branded portfolio have underperformed this year. This variability in product performance could affect overall revenue stability.

Supply Chain Disruption: ImprimisRx experienced an inventory shortage in October, leading to a one-time revenue decrease of $4 million to $6 million for the fourth quarter.

Seasonal Revenue Fluctuations: The company anticipates a typical seasonal decline in revenue from Q4 2025 to Q1 2026, which could impact financial performance.

Strategic Execution Risks: The company is preparing for multiple product launches over the next three years, which requires significant coordination and investment. Any delays or missteps could impact growth projections.

Guidance & Outlook

Revenue Outlook: The company updated its full-year revenue outlook to a range of $270 million to $280 million for 2025, slightly lowering the original target of over $280 million. This adjustment reflects a more conservative approach, though the original target is still within reach.

Product Launches: Harrow plans to launch four new products over the next three years: BYOOVIZ (mid-2026), OPUVIZ (mid-2027), BYQLOVI, and MELT-300. These launches are expected to significantly expand the company's market reach and growth potential.

VEVYE Growth: VEVYE is expected to achieve record revenue in 2025, nearing its $100 million annual revenue target. Improved coverage starting in January 2026, including preferred status on major formularies, is anticipated to drive further growth and pricing stability.

IHEEZO Growth: IHEEZO is projected to have a strong finish to 2025, with expectations of record revenue driven by increased adoption and end-of-year ordering patterns. The product is positioned for continued growth into 2026.

TRIESENCE Expansion: TRIESENCE has entered the ocular inflammation market, its largest opportunity to date, with positive early feedback. The company expects this launch to act as a catalyst for significant growth in this segment.

Rare & Specialty Products: The Rare & Specialty portfolio is being revitalized with new leadership and the launch of the Harrow Access for All program. This segment is expected to return to growth and exceed its previous revenue levels.

Commercial Infrastructure: Harrow plans to expand its commercial infrastructure, including opening 10 additional sales territories for VEVYE in 2026, to support the next phase of growth.

Seasonality Impact: The company anticipates a typical seasonal decline in revenue from Q4 2025 to Q1 2026, consistent with historical patterns, but expects record results for the full year 2026.

Key Q&A

Q:Could you talk about VEVYE prescription data and why we don't see it this quarter?
A:Mark Baum explained that they decided to ensure the most accurate information by withdrawing from some data reporting services for competitive reasons. They are focusing on revenue generated from products rather than potentially inaccurate third-party data. Andrew Boll added that presenting such data could compromise competitive positioning.
Q:Could you talk about the leverage you're achieving on SG&A and how to think about leverage overall into 2026?
A:Andrew Boll stated that they are seeing operating leverage due to prior investments in operational and commercial infrastructure. Q3 showed great adjusted EBITDA of just under $23 million and $16 million in cash from operations. Future investments in commercial infrastructure are expected to generate immediate returns on revenue without a significant increase in OpEx.
Q:Could you define the magnitude of the modest ASP decline for VEVYE in Q3 and explain the assumptions for ASP stabilization?
A:Mark Baum stated the decline was less than 10%. ASP stabilization is expected due to increased coverage and a shift from cash pay to covered prescriptions. A major coverage win with the largest U.S. pharmacy benefit manager is expected to drive this shift starting January 1, 2026.
Q:Can you share more specifics about the largest PBM coverage win for VEVYE and its impact on ASP and volume?
A:Mark Baum confirmed the win involves commercial lives, which are highly attractive. He emphasized the potential for significant ASP improvement (e.g., $20 per unit) and volume growth due to the coverage win. The company plans to expand territories to capitalize on this opportunity.
Q:What proportion of VEVYE cash pay patients do you expect to transition to insurance coverage in 2026, and what impact will this have on net price per unit?
A:Mark Baum stated they cannot provide precise numbers but expect a significant transition due to the preferred status of VEVYE under the largest commercial PBM. This is expected to improve ASP and drive volume growth.
Q:Are you doing anything to keep patients on VEVYE until insurance coverage kicks in, and is there any expected inventory impact in Q4?
A:Mark Baum and Patrick Sullivan mentioned a high-touch program to support patients and drive conversion. Andrew Boll stated there is no significant inventory impact expected in Q4 as specialty pharmacies order just-in-time.
Q:Could you comment on the notably high $80 million revenue threshold in Q4 and the dynamics driving it?
A:Mark Baum attributed the growth to the emergence of TRIESENCE and volume improvements across the portfolio. Andrew Boll added that end-of-year dynamics, such as lower co-pay buydowns, may also contribute to revenue growth.
Q:What is the conversion rate from cash pay to commercial insurance for VEVYE under Project Beagle, and what is the new price point for TRIESENCE?
A:Mark Baum stated that most Klarity-C patients have transitioned to VEVYE. TRIESENCE pricing was reduced to better compete in the ocular inflammation market, which has led to new orders and positive adoption trends.
Q:Is it easy to reengage TRIESENCE users, and are you adding conventional salespeople for VEVYE?
A:Mark Baum explained that reengaging TRIESENCE users takes time but is progressing well. The company plans to expand VEVYE territories to 100 by mid-next year and has added FLAREX and FRESHKOTE to the sales team's portfolio.
Q:What is the duration of therapy for commercially covered VEVYE patients?
A:Mark Baum stated that commercially covered VEVYE patients typically stay on therapy for nearly the entire year, with refill rates exceeding expectations.
Q:What should we anticipate in terms of business development in 2026-2027?
A:Mark Baum highlighted the transformative potential of the Melt acquisition, which aligns with their vision for opioid-free, drop-free cataract surgery. The company is focused on executing its current portfolio but remains open to new deals.
Q:Could you provide additional color on market dynamics for VEVYE prescriptions flipping from other products?
A:Mark Baum stated that prescriptions flipping to VEVYE are primarily from non-cyclosporine anti-inflammatory products. The company aims to become the #1 cyclosporine in the market, leveraging new coverage to drive growth.
